Synopsis

For more than 30 years, Dr. Anneliese and Dr. Wulf Crueger - guided by Saeko Ito - have devoted themselves to studying, understanding, and collecting Japanese ceramics. Today, they share their knowledge with this lavishly illustrated volume based on their own collection. The equivalent of "Roberts Museum Guide", devotees of beautiful ceramics can pick it up and use it to select and visit potters as they undertake an artistic tour of the country. Organised geographically, it goes from kiln to kiln - which in Japan may refer to a lone site or an entire ceramics region that contains hundreds of workshops. Along the way, they outline the history, development, and unique stylistic characteristics of each area's work, and the traditions that inspired it.
